Chemical Pneumonia
Lung inflammation caused by inhalation of chemical irritants, leading to symptoms like coughing, chest pain, and breathing difficulties.
Lead-Based Paint
Paint that contains lead, a toxic metal, used in many homes before the 1978 U.S. ban, and can cause health problems if ingested or inhaled.
Acute Childhood
Refers to the sudden onset of disease or medical conditions during childhood.
Lead Poisoning
A medical condition caused by high levels of lead in the body, which can damage the nervous system, kidneys, and other major organs.
